dotnet-watch
|
|
===
|
|
`dotnet-watch` is a file watcher for `dotnet` that restarts the specified application when changes in the source code are detected.
|
|
|
|
### How To Install
|
|
|
|
Add `dotnet-watch` to the `tools` section of your `project.json` file:
|
|
|
|
```
|
|
{
|
|
...
|
|
"tools": {
|
|
"dotnet-watch": "1.0.0-*"
|
|
}
|
|
...
|
|
}
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
### How To Use
|
|
|
|
```dotnet watch <watcher args> -- <app args>```
|
|
|
|
- `dotnet watch` (runs the application without arguments)
|
|
- `dotnet watch foo bar` (runs the application with the arguments `foo bar`)
|
|
- `dotnet watch --exit-on-change -- foo bar` (runs the application with the arguments `foo bar`. In addition, it passes `--exit-on-change` to the watcher).
|
|
- `dotnet watch --command test -- -parallel none` (runs `dotnet test` with the arguments `-parallel none`)
